The technical paper on Critical Materials for the Energy Transition emphasises that an accelerated energy transition requires a growing supply of critical materials, with Chapter 7 of the IRENA’s World Energy Transition Outlook 2022 further elaborating on these materials. IRENA continues to publish technical papers on groups of critical materials: the first one focuses on lithium and this second paper focuses on rare earth elements.

This technical paper examines demand and market growth projections for electric vehicles and wind turbines and explores the efficiency of rare earths’ use. It pays special attention to patent activity in magnets around the world. On the supply side, it explores: the outlook for the mining and processing of rare earths; current costs and their implications; and approaches to enhance the security of rare earth elements supply. The paper also delves deeper into the opportunities that innovation can play in reducing dependency on rare earths and discusses related policy implications.

Optics or Optical Components are used to alter the state of light through a variety of means, including focusing, filtering, reflecting, or polarizing. Optical Components are integrated into a limitless number of applications, such as microscopy, imaging, or interferometry, for industries ranging from the life sciences to testing and measurement. Optical Components are often designed using specific substrates or anti-reflection coatings to optimize performance in designated ultraviolet, visible, or infrared wavelengths or wavelength ranges.
